Executive team,

As Marla Venn joins as incoming director of operations, please note we have recorded a write-down on slow-moving Ferrowave component stock at the Kelden Hollow warehouse. The adjustment reflects obsolescence following the Ferrowave II launch and a revised demand forecast. Procurement has paused replenishment, and disposal options are being assessed with two salvage buyers. Margins for the quarter will absorb the charge without covenant impact. The confidential note below outlines how this feeds into next year's sourcing plan.

internal memo for kawip-hadug: Headcount on the Wenwyn team goes from 7 to 140 by the end of January. Gross margin on Wenwyn came in at 20 percent against a plan of 15 percent.

Step 4 — Rebuilding the autocomplete index. If suggestions on Quillbird feel sluggish after deploy, the typeahead index probably didn't warm up. Run the reindex job from the jobs box, but first make sure the indexer can reach the suggestion store. Add this line to the worker's env file before kicking it off:

vault entry, bajop-fahog: VAULT_KEY20=78eabf78646e2944df7e

Action item (owner: on-call): During the Pairwise matching-service incident, GC pauses on the order-matching nodes exceeded 900ms, causing heartbeat timeouts and a spurious failover. We need to tune the heap sizing and switch the matcher pods to the low-pause collector profile before next Tuesday's traffic peak. Please capture GC logs for 48 hours after the change and attach them to the ticket. The full tuning checklist and rollback steps are documented on the internal page here.

operations page: https://jenkins.zemvarcloud.local/job/merge_requests/repo/build/73930b4b30f0a8ed

**Q: How do we slim container images for Brackenfold services?**

Use the `slimcut` stage in the base pipeline. It strips build tools, docs, and locale files. Multi-stage builds only; no exceptions. If slimming breaks the signing layer, you must unlock the image-signing vault manually and rebuild. The vault's recovery passphrase is noted directly below.

recovery phrase for fajep-yaweg: gilath-sorox-wenius-rusdor-keliel-zorius